List of safety features
Huawei phones come with a series of built-in security measures to keep your data secure.
Full-disk encryption
All data on the memory chipset is automatically encrypted. Each
phone has a different security key, meaning that other devices
cannot access the data stored on your phone's memory chipset.
Fingerprint
recognition
Your phone comes with a fingerprint sensor to give you quick and
easy access to your phone's features. For example, you can use
your fingerprint to unlock the screen, access files in your Safe,
open locked applications, and more. For more information, see
Using fingerprint recognition.
Harassment filter
Use the harassment filter in Phone Manager to block spam calls
and messages. For more information, see
Harassment filter.
App Lock
Use the App Lock in Phone Manager to lock applications and
prevent unauthorized access. The App Lock password is required
to open locked applications.
Managing data
usage
Use the data management feature in Phone Manager to keep track
of your mobile data usage. Mobile data will be automatically
disabled when you exceed the preset limit to prevent you from
incurring excessive data charges. For more information, see
Managing data usage.
Safe
Enable the Safe feature, set a password, and then add your
confidential files to prevent unauthorized access. For more
information, see
Storing private files in a safe.
SIM lock
Set a SIM card PIN to protect the data stored on your SIM card. If
you have enabled PIN protection for your SIM card, you will need
to enter the PIN each time you turn on your phone or insert the
SIM card into another phone. For more information, see
Setting
your SIM card PIN.
Screen unlock
method
Choose from a range of screen unlock methods to prevent
unauthorized access to your phone. For more information, see
Changing the screen unlock method.

Huawei P9 LITE Specifications

General IconGeneral
Display diagonal5.2 \
Orientation sensor-
Audio formats supportedAAC, AMR, AWB, FLAC, MID, MP3, MP4, OGG, WAV
Video formats supported3GP, MKV, MP4, WEBM
Processor cores4
Processor familyHi-Silicon
Processor frequency2 GHz
Coprocessor frequency1.7 GHz
Processor lithography16 nm
Coprocessor architectureARM Cortex-A53
RAM capacity3 GB
Compatible memory cardsMicroSD (TransFlash)
Maximum memory card size128 GB
Internal storage capacity16 GB
Flash typeLED
Front camera typeSingle camera
Rear camera resolution (numeric)13 MP
Front camera resolution (numeric)8 MP
Battery capacity3000 mAh
2G standardsGSM
3G standardsUMTS
SIM card typeNanoSIM
Wi-Fi standards802.11b, 802.11g, Wi-Fi 4 (802.11n)
3G bands supported900, 1900, 2100 MHz
SIM card capabilitySingle SIM
2G bands (primary SIM)850, 900, 1800, 1900 MHz
Mobile network generation4G
Graphics cardMali T830
Graphics & IMC lithography28 nm
USB connector typeMicro-USB
HDMI ports quantity0
Headphone connectivity3.5 mm
Form factorBar
Product colorWhite
PlatformAndroid
Operating system installedAndroid 6.0
Storage temperature (T-T)-20 - 45 °C
Operating temperature (T-T)0 - 35 °C
Cables includedUSB
Weight and Dimensions IconWeight and Dimensions
Depth7.5 mm
Width72.6 mm
Height146.8 mm
Weight147 g
